Ghost pokemon are some of my favorites, I like their concepts and their power, Gengar is actually one of my all time favorites, so the questions is, with the next season eventually coming around, what sort of creepies will we be getting this time around? They've already played around with ghosts, banshees, balloons (they are ghostly now?), bug shells, and so forth. Here's a few of my ideas. Bonbori: The Paper Lantern Pokemon Type: Ghost/Fire Design: A small round paper lantern, purple/black in color with sleepy little red eyes. Has an ornate design on the front and a glow coming from inside of it, based after a paper lantern. Name concept: A Bonbori is acually the name of a small Japanese paper lantern, in addition Bon- can allude to a bonfire, a fire. Ability: Intimidate/Levitate Strengths: Special Attack, Special Defense Weaknesses: Hit Points, Defense (it is made of paper afterall) Evolves into: Chochin: The Paper Lantern Pokemon Type: Ghost/Fire Design: A larger paper lantern design, long with an opening in the middle like a mouth, showing off an eerie flame inside. Its eyes now look a little more playful/sinister and the design on the front is more detailed, possibly written to mean something like "Haunted" or "Possessed". Name concept: Again a chōchin is a type of Japanese paper lantern, considered naming him Charchin, but figured that alluded too much to the Charmander family, so left it as it. Many Japanese Oni's are actually designed after haunted paper lanterns so the concept isn't really that far out of place. Ability: Intimidate/Levitate Strengths: Special Attack, Special Defense Weaknesses: Defense (Hit Points improve to being average) Moves: More than likely starts with Will-o-Wisp, and then probabaly gets Night Shade soon after, two fitting moves for a Ghost Lantern. Other than that, basic moves from the fire/ghost pool seem alright, as well as some intimidation moves possibly, given its ghostly appearance. Would be nice if at high levels it could have something like Sacred Flame, but probably not much chance of that since its still a Ho-Oh exclusive. |
